Which scientist studies biotic factors?

Answers

Answer 1
Answer: The scientist that studies biotic factors would be a biologist. The reason for this is the fact that biologists are scientists who study all living things which are also all the biotic factors. Although it is also true that other scientists could be studying biotic factors as well.

A membrane that allows only some materials to move in and out of the cell is

Answers

A membrane like that is called semi permeable, because only certain materials can pass through it.

Which of the following is the only marsupial found in North America?

Answers

The opossum is the only marsupial found on North America. It is found in many locations and is fairly commonly seen rummaging through waste and other leftover areas looking for things to scavenge. Opossums are known for taking any opportunity it can to find waste products and eat them.
